A 72-year-old female sustained a left radius fracture, resulting in volar angulation, radial shortening and loss of radioulnar i

nclination. a general anesthetic was administered. a standard dorsal central approach to the wrist was made. the capsule was opened in a t fashion and the malunion site was identified. a series of osteotomes was utilized to open the fracture site and the normal distal radial architecture was restored. the pie-plate was placed on the distal radius utilizing a combination of 2.0 and 1.8 screws and threaded pins for the distal segment and 2.7 screws proximally. fragments were secured, and norian srs was packed into the defect and allowed to harden. with this completed, the wounds were copiously irrigated with normal saline. soft tissue was closed over the plate and distal radius, and secured with 2-0 vicryl. what cpt® code is reported?

The answer is 25400-LT. the explanation behind this is this is not the reparation of a fracture; it is repair of a malunion. In the CPT® Index look for Repair/Radius/Malunion or Nonunion, 25400, 25405, 25415, 25420. Code 25400 reports repair of a malunion of the radius. There is no indication of an autograft; hence, 25405 is incorrect. Norian SRS is a biocompatible bone gap filler, not a graft. Modifier LT is added to indicate the procedure is executed on the left side.

What food product is most likely to be enriched with thiamin niacin riboflavin and iron?
svlad2 [7]

Refined grain products like bread, flour tortillas, white rice, cornmeal, crackers etc are enriched with riboflavin, niacin, iron and thiamin.

Enriched grains is finely ground endosperm of the kernel. Enriched grain products are good as a source of iron and four types of vitamin B which includes niacin, thiamin, folic acid and riboflavin and also contains some complex carbohydrates.

Wheat and rice are a staple diet in many regions of the world but excessive polishing and refining the cereals removes the essential nutrients or vitamins which have their own important physiological roles.

Explain why most farmers use stem cuttings to plant new fruit trees rather than plant seeds.
Dvinal [7]

The main reason that most farmers use stem cuttings rather than just planting a seed is that a tree's genetic variation will occur. The seeds of many fruit trees tend to vary differently from the parent, because seeds themselves are produced by sexual reproduction (i.e they receive genes from a male and female to form). As they are a cross from two sets of genes, many fruit trees are not “true to seed”. Their seeds will produce a generally different variety of tree from the parent. When using stem cuttings, it's almost like a cloning process.
